About this property

  • Victorian 2/3 bed split level conversion

  • Private ground floor access

  • Private garden

  • Top floor room requires refurbishment - excellent potential

  • Share of freehold

  • 0.1 miles to clock house br station

  • 0.3 miles to beckenham road tramlink

Oozing character and period charm, Charles Eden are delighted to present this Victorian era conversion arranged over three floors offering 2/3 bedrooms, a private garden, and endless potential, all just moments from excellent transport links.

Covered Entrance

Part glazed door leading into lobby.
Carpeted stairs to:

Stairs To First Floor

Part paneled walls, fitted carpet.

Landing

Part panelled walls, hardwood flooring.

Reception Room

Glazed sash window to rear, coved ceiling, ceiling rose, radiator housed in ornate radiator cover, feature fireplace with open grate, built-in base cupboards to one alcove, fitted carpet.
Double mirror doors opening to:

Dining Room

Radiator housed in ornate radiator cover, laminate wood flooring.

Kitchen

Glazed sash window to rear, recessed spot lights to ceiling, coved ceiling, range of wall and base units with worksurfaces over, stainless steel single bowl sink with mixer tap, four ring electric hob, single oven and microwave housed in tall oven unit, space for washing machine, fridge and freezer, part tiled walls, tiled flooring.

Bedroom One

Glazed sash bay windows to front, coved ceiling, ceiling rose, radiator, fitted carpet.
Door leading into:

Dressing Room (Originally Third Bedroom)

Glazed sash window to front, range of fitted wardrobes, radiator, hardwood flooring.
Agents note: We understand this was originally a bedroom however the seller blocked the entrance to the landing to create the dressing room which connects from the main bedroom

Bathroom/Wc

Two windows to side with shutters, roll top bath with claw feet and free standing chrome taps, wash hand basin with taps, low level WC, chrome ladder style heated towel rail, fully tiled walls, tiled flooring.

Stairs To Second Floor

Paneled walls, fitted carpet.

Landing

Velux style roof window.

Bedroom Two

Three Velux style roof windows, recessed spot lights to ceiling, eaves storage areas, floor boards.

Outside

Rear Garden

Located to rear of the garden with shrubs, crazy paved patio area, and ornamental gravel.

Lease

148 years from December 2001
124 years remaining

Maintainance Charge

Agents note: There are no annual maintenance charges but we understand, when repairs are required, these are split with the neighbouring property on an ad hoc basis.

Building Insurance £431.34 p.a.

Council Tax D

Epc Rating D
